What happens when the official story of economic growth no longer matches the life people are actually living?
YOU ARE NOT POOR. THE ECONOMY IS GROWING. is an independent political-economic investigation of Australia, told through public records and everyday conversations.
It follows public promises, government decisions, legislation, official statistics, inquiries and measurable outcomes — then asks where those decisions actually land in housing, energy, food, work, debt, business, family life and the pressure carried by ordinary Australians.
This is not a conspiracy theory, and it does not ask the reader to inherit a political conclusion.
It asks a harder question:
What does the record actually show when the pieces are placed together?
The book separates verified record, documented controversy, interpretation and ordinary composite conversations so the reader can examine the evidence without being told what to think.
